ESPN Layoffs
Good bye Ed Werber and Jason Stark, who's on the list?
WPO Link
In a message sent Wednesday to ESPN employees, network president John Skipper announced the company was beginning its next round of layoffs, a long-anticipated move that is expected to thin the ranks of ESPN’s on-air and online talent.
